GOOD value can be had in Ballincollig at the moment, as O’Mahony Walsh are offering a four-bed detached house for €230,000.
Fitting home for a growing family

While it is stand alone, so to speak, number 12 Aisling Close is a linked house in this estate which is near the new Ballincollig bypass.

And fittings are very good for instance, solid maple floors run through the ground floor and fireplaces are also above standard.

The two main reception rooms interconnect and the kitchen is fitted with oak units. The ground floor also includes a guest loo and fully fitted utility as well as a study/fourth bedrooms.

All four bedrooms have laminate floors and some come with fitted wardrobes. The main bathroom is also fully tiled. Outside, the house has a good back garden, with block built shed and front garden with parking area and lawn. Heating is by oil.

Terence O'Leary of O'Mahony Walsh Property Partners is looking for a quick sale and says they can also offer fast, vacant possession.
